Defining Fake Christianity

  • 💡 Fake Christianity is defined as any instance, intentional or unintentional, where individuals are not aligned with what God desires them to do, feel, or think.
  • 🎭 This definition stems from Jesus's use of the term hypocrisy, which is considered the core of inauthentic faith.
  • ⚠️ Both genuine believers and those with false faith can struggle with aspects of fake Christianity, especially while awaiting Christ's return.

Ministry Background and Book Genesis

  • 🎤 Pastor Jed Coppenger's book, "Fake Christianity," was inspired by a sermon on Matthew 23, Jesus's last public message focusing on false faith.
  • 🎯 The publisher requested a follow-up to his book on prayer, and prayer led him to this topic.
  • 🧩 Coppenger believes the biggest obstacles to an abundant life are often small, seemingly insignificant battles that can lead to significant breakthroughs when addressed.

Trends in Faith and Culture

  • 📉 A decline in regular church attendance in the US is noted, with about 30% of Americans attending weekly.
  • ⏳ This decline is not solely a modern issue; the writer of Hebrews addressed similar concerns in the first century.
